THE HEALTH DANGERS OF ASBESTOS
Asbestos when it's left undisturbed doesn't carry any health risks. Only when it is scraped or cut can tiny asbestos fibres or particles be discharged into the air. When these fibres find their way into lungs by breathing, they can cause a health condition with the name, asbestosis. It's been discovered that asbestos fibres or particles are also a contributary factor in lung cancer and mesothelioma.
There is no known cure for asbestosis and the scarring to the lungs caused by the asbestos fibres cannot be reversed.
The symptoms of asbestosis could include:
- Wheezing
- Acute Shortness of Breath
- Pain in Your Shoulders or Chest
- Extreme Fatigue
- Chronic Cough
If you experience one of these symptoms and you have been in contact with asbestos over a period of time, you should call your doctor and get their advice.

WHAT YOU NEED TO CONSIDER WHEN DEALING WITH ASBESTOS
Asbestos was extensively used in UK building and construction projects from 1945 - 1985, but it was only banned from being used in 1999. Many older homes and properties could therefore contain asbestos in certain sections of the structure. Asbestos may be found in any part of an older structure because it was used as a fireproofing and insulating product in a wide variety of areas.
Stumbling upon asbestos in your South Kirkby home doesn't add up to an immediate threat. Bear in mind that asbestos is usually only a hazard to health if disturbed. There are certain situations where it may be better to leave the asbestos in situ, making sure that it's not disturbed or damaged. If you're in any doubt or would like to know safe ways to deal with asbestos in your property you'll want to contact a certified asbestos removal company in South Kirkby for guidance and advice.
There are different degrees of health risk relating to the asbestos products that might be found in older buildings. For example, asbestos insulation boards, pipe lagging and loose fill insulation are looked upon as higher risk than asbestos cement sheets and roofing panels. Only a registered asbestos removal firm in South Kirkby is capable of detecting, removing and getting rid of any products made from asbestos, in a safe and environmentally friendly fashion.
If the removal of asbestos has a requirement for a HSE license holder to carry out the process, then the Health & Safety Executive or the local authority must be informed. The Control of Asbestos Regulations 2012 are the procedures that your asbestos removal contractor must comply with so as to safeguard people and work areas from asbestos particles and fibre.
You may very well be prosecuted if you undertake any asbestos removal that calls for a permit from the Health and Safety Executive if you don't hold that particular license.

ASBESTOS DISPOSAL South Kirkby
As soon as any asbestos has been stripped away from your South Kirkby property it's then regarded as hazardous waste. There are rigorous procedures needed to dispose of any hazardous waste, especially that containing asbestos products. A professional asbestos removal firm in South Kirkby will comply with all of the regulations and guidelines outlined by the local authority and the HSE.
If the asbestos material is loose fibre asbestos or if it has been damaged and broken, it has to be moved in line with the Carriage of Dangerous Goods Act 2009 (CDG 2009). The CDG 2009 act states a separate waste carrier's license is needed and the asbestos waste has to be removed to a licensed hazardous waste disposal facility. To put your mind at rest the use of a registered South Kirkby asbestos removal specialist gives them the obligation to follow all guidelines and rules, including the keeping of all disposal records for three years, at the least in case it is required for reference in the future.
PHASES OF WORK
Before any actual work starts on getting rid of any questionable materials from your South Kirkby property you'll want to make sure that it is asbestos. Only a registered asbestos surveyor or contractor can lawfully determine asbestos and the strategies needed for the removal and disposing of it. You may possibly choose not to conduct an asbestos survey on your building, but if it was built in the period between 1945 and 1999, you must assume there is in fact asbestos present and follow all safety precautions.
A certified asbestos surveyor will carry out all inspections, sampling and testing should be independent of your asbestos removal contractor.

The Health and Safety Executive or local authority must be informed at least 14 days before any asbestos removal work begins, that needs a certified contractor to complete the task. The necessary documents will be supplied by the asbestos removal company and needs to include: 1. A definitive method for sample testing and also clearing up after the removal work is completed. 2. All hazardous waste disposal training & testing, medical certificates, risk assessments and work licenses for the specific task. 3. A written work report of the legislation, guidelines and regulations for the assignment. 4. As soon as the four stage asbestos clearance procedure have been accomplished, the Certificate of Reoccupation from an accredited organisation will be provided.
All necessary health & safety precautions for the workforce, including personal protective equipment (PPE), will be supplied by the asbestos removal contractor and they will make sure all hazardous waste is safely removed to an authorised waste disposal centre.

Types of Asbestos

Occurring naturally on every continent of the world, asbestos is a fibrous material that was used in the manufacturing and construction industries from the end of the 19th century until it was banned altogether in the British Isles in the late 1990s. In all there are 6 different types of asbestos, all of which are minerals part of the serpentine and amphibole groups, namely - chrysotile, amosite, crocidolite, tremolite, actinolite and anthophyllite.
For the purpose of this short article we shall be considering the 3 main types that were most widely used in products found in Britain. Those are: chrysotile, crocidolite and amosite.
Amosite (Brown Asbestos or Grunerite) - Also called brown asbestos, amosite asbestos or grunerite is typically found in vinyl tiles, fire protection, pipe insulation, roofing materials, insulating board and cement sheets. The second most dangerous type of asbestos is a part of the Amphibole family.
Crocidolite (Blue Asbestos) - Considered to be the most dangerous of all the asbestos types is crocidolite (often called blue asbestos). It was frequently used for insulating steam engines, and also for pipe lagging, plastics, cement products and spray-on coatings.
Chrysotile (White Asbestos) - Chrysotile asbestos, often known as white asbestos, was the most commonly used of all these materials. In South Kirkby homes and buildings, it is still often found in roofs, walls, floors, insulation and ceilings. It can also be found in many manufactured products such as pipe & duct insulation, brake linings, boiler seals and gaskets.
Interesting Facts: Scarily, blue asbestos was even used in the manufacture of cigarette filters, therefore in the nineteen fifties smokers were actually breathing this dangerous material directly into their lungs. At that time (1952-56) it was promoted as a health benefit, making it even more improbable! So, the Lorillard Tobacco Company (Greensboro, NC) must get the award "blunder of the century", for putting the most deadly form of asbestos fibres (crocidolite) into the filters of their Kent Micronite cigarettes, and bragging that it was a safety feature. Over sixty years later lawsuits are still being brought by those affected by this scandal. Many of the claimants were affected by a rare and aggressive kind of cancer known as mesothelioma.
Asbestos Sampling South Kirkby

Asbestos testing or sampling involves the analysis of suspicious materials to ascertain whether or not they contain any asbestos. If you've a material believed to contain asbestos in your property in South Kirkby, a sample must be taken and sent for analysis. Such things as roof tiles, duct/pipe coverings, floor tiles, garage roofs, insulation board, guttering and textured coatings, are among the most common asbestos containing materials in buildings. Any South Kirkby building that is going through major renovations, and was built before 2000 will have to be inspected for asbestos containing materials before any work commences.
The Control of Asbestos Regulations 2012 demand that all testing of asbestos containing materials (ACMs) has to be performed by a UKAS accredited company (ISO 17025). Although you may notice asbestos testing kits being advertised on the web, it is neither advisable nor reliable to use these for establishing whether you've got ACMs within your property. Always use the professionals for your asbestos testing and sampling - be on the safe side, even if it costs you a little more.
Asbestos Encapsulation South Kirkby
In certain situations when asbestos is found inside a building in South Kirkby it might not be necessary to actually remove it, but instead encapsulate the ACM's (asbestos containing materials). With asbestos encapsulation, the ACM's are covered with a protective membrane which may involve a rigid sheet, a cloth wrap or a sprayed or painted coating, to both stop the harmful asbestos fibres from being released into the air and safeguard the ACM from being compromised. A comprehensive asbestos risk assessment will need to be carried out on the ACM's so as to determine whether or not they can be encapsulated.
Asbestos Awareness Courses South Kirkby

Available across the UK, courses on asbestos awareness provide workers and tradesmen with guidance for avoiding the possibility of contact with asbestos products. What is gained from an asbestos awareness course doesn't allow anyone to remove, work on or dispose of hazardous asbestos in any way. However, if they come across materials that may contain asbestos (ACM's) in the workplace, employees and supervisors must be able to recognise them, understand what procedures are required, and take the correct steps to safeguard themselves and everybody else.
Asbestos awareness courses deal with the following facts:
- Effects on the human body from asbestos exposure
- Avoiding the possibility of exposure to asbestos
- Areas where you are likely to find asbestos
- What action to take if asbestos is accidentally disturbed or particles of asbestos is discharged into the atmosphere
Courses in asbestos awareness are also available online and offer an excellent way to get rapid certification on the hazards of asbestos. An online course might possibly be your only option if you aren't able to find an actual physical asbestos awareness course in South Kirkby itself.

Training Courses for Asbestos Removal

The Asbestos Testing and Consultancy Association (ATaC) provide a number of asbestos related training courses, for anybody who wishes to earn certificates in asbestos management, asbestos surveying, asbestos removal and asbestos analysis. The courses that are currently available are RSPH Level 3 Award in Asbestos Bulk Analysis, RSPH Level 3 Award in Asbestos Air Monitoring and Clearance Procedures, RSPH Level 3 Award in Asbestos Surveying, RSPH Level 4 Certificate in Asbestos Laboratory and Project Management and Remote RSH Level 3 Award in Asbestos Management for Dutyholders. These qualifications are provided through the Royal Society for Public Health (RSPH), and have been created especially for specialists involved with asbestos management, who are working within UKAS authorised businesses.
